Okaloosa EMS Recognized for Heart Attack Care

Drone above an Okaloosa EMS Ambulance

For the seventh year in a row, Okaloosa County Department of Public Safety – EMS Division has received the American Heart Association’s Mission: Lifeline® EMS Gold Plus achievement award for its commitment to offering rapid, research-based care to people experiencing the most severe form of heart attack, ultimately saving lives.

Niceville Public Works To Close Edge Avenue for Building Removal

Niceville’s Public Works Department told commuters they will close Edge avenue between John Sims Parkway and Bayshore Drive to remove an abandoned building on April 25th.
